python计算一到n的和
@狄步5665:python编程计算前30项的和:s=1+(1+2)+(1+2+3)+(1+2+3+4)+…+(1+2+3+4+…+n)? -
瞿和13640107904…… sum([sum(range(i+1)) for i in range(1,31)])
@狄步5665:python求整数各位数字之和 -
瞿和13640107904…… 今天我们要实现这样一个功能:计算1到任意一个我们给出的整数之间的数字之和是多少? 1、运行时,系统提示请输入数字: 2、系统给出运算结果 1到输入数字之间的数字之和为:多少; 3、输入数字为0时,程序结束运行; 运行的结果如...
@狄步5665:python编写一个函数my - sum2,其功能是根据给定的数N求得从1到N间所有能被3整除的数的和,并将其返回 - 作业帮
瞿和13640107904…… [答案] def my_sum2(N): return sum([x for x in range(1, N) if x%3==0])print my_sum2(10)
@狄步5665:怎样在python中生成一串0到n的数字名相加 -
瞿和13640107904…… def print_plus(n): t = n+1 for i in range(t): ostr = str(i) if i == 0: strs = ostr + '+' elif i strs += ostr + '+' else: strs += ostr else: return strs print print_plus(6)代码如上.结果如图:
@狄步5665:python输入正整数n,计算从1到n之间所有偶数的平方和,不含n,直接输出结果? -
瞿和13640107904…… 代码来:源2113 #encoding=utf-8 n = int(input('Input N: ')) sum=0 for i in range(1,n): if i % 2 == 0: sum = sum + i*i #print('%d,%d\n' % (i,i*i)) print(sum) 结果5261:41021653 Input N: 10 120
@狄步5665:Python计算1到100的和,跳过30到40之间的数
瞿和13640107904…… '''Python计算1到100的和,跳过30到40之间的数''' n=0 for i in range(100): i=i+1 if i<30 or i>40: n=n+i print(i,n)
@狄步5665:python表示从1乘到n -
瞿和13640107904…… x = 1y = int(input("请输入要计算的数:"))for i in range(1, y + 1): x = x * iprint(x)
@狄步5665:python 怎么算矩阵每列的和 -
瞿和13640107904…… output = [] nrow = len(mat) ncol = len(mat[0]) for i in range(ncol): output.append(sum([mat[x][i] for x in range(nrow)])) print output
@狄步5665:python编写程序,计算并显示1 - 1000以内(含1000)是三倍数或7倍数的所有自然数之和.求大佬解答 -
瞿和13640107904…… 方法一: sum = 0; for n in range(1,1001): if n%3 == 0 or n%7 == 0: sum += n; print(sum)方法二: print(sum([n for n in range(1,1001) if n%3 == 0 or n%7 == 0]))
@狄步5665:用python写函数,输入一个正整数,计算1到它的相加后的结果 -
瞿和13640107904…… >>> def getnb(): nb = int(input('输入一个整数:')) return nb + 1 >>> getnb() 输入一个整数:10 11 >>>
瞿和13640107904…… sum([sum(range(i+1)) for i in range(1,31)])
@狄步5665:python求整数各位数字之和 -
瞿和13640107904…… 今天我们要实现这样一个功能:计算1到任意一个我们给出的整数之间的数字之和是多少? 1、运行时,系统提示请输入数字: 2、系统给出运算结果 1到输入数字之间的数字之和为:多少; 3、输入数字为0时,程序结束运行; 运行的结果如...
@狄步5665:python编写一个函数my - sum2,其功能是根据给定的数N求得从1到N间所有能被3整除的数的和,并将其返回 - 作业帮
瞿和13640107904…… [答案] def my_sum2(N): return sum([x for x in range(1, N) if x%3==0])print my_sum2(10)
@狄步5665:怎样在python中生成一串0到n的数字名相加 -
瞿和13640107904…… def print_plus(n): t = n+1 for i in range(t): ostr = str(i) if i == 0: strs = ostr + '+' elif i strs += ostr + '+' else: strs += ostr else: return strs print print_plus(6)代码如上.结果如图:
@狄步5665:python输入正整数n,计算从1到n之间所有偶数的平方和,不含n,直接输出结果? -
瞿和13640107904…… 代码来:源2113 #encoding=utf-8 n = int(input('Input N: ')) sum=0 for i in range(1,n): if i % 2 == 0: sum = sum + i*i #print('%d,%d\n' % (i,i*i)) print(sum) 结果5261:41021653 Input N: 10 120
@狄步5665:Python计算1到100的和,跳过30到40之间的数
瞿和13640107904…… '''Python计算1到100的和,跳过30到40之间的数''' n=0 for i in range(100): i=i+1 if i<30 or i>40: n=n+i print(i,n)
@狄步5665:python表示从1乘到n -
瞿和13640107904…… x = 1y = int(input("请输入要计算的数:"))for i in range(1, y + 1): x = x * iprint(x)
@狄步5665:python 怎么算矩阵每列的和 -
瞿和13640107904…… output = [] nrow = len(mat) ncol = len(mat[0]) for i in range(ncol): output.append(sum([mat[x][i] for x in range(nrow)])) print output
@狄步5665:python编写程序,计算并显示1 - 1000以内(含1000)是三倍数或7倍数的所有自然数之和.求大佬解答 -
瞿和13640107904…… 方法一: sum = 0; for n in range(1,1001): if n%3 == 0 or n%7 == 0: sum += n; print(sum)方法二: print(sum([n for n in range(1,1001) if n%3 == 0 or n%7 == 0]))
@狄步5665:用python写函数,输入一个正整数,计算1到它的相加后的结果 -
瞿和13640107904…… >>> def getnb(): nb = int(input('输入一个整数:')) return nb + 1 >>> getnb() 输入一个整数:10 11 >>>